When you are painting a large piece, sometimes it makes sense to use a spray paint for your base color because it applies quickly and dries quickly. If you are wondering whether you can use oil paint on top of a base like this, you’re not the only one. It is a very common question!
So, will oil paint stick to spray paint? Yes. Oil paint can be applied on top of spray paint. You want to make sure you use a matte spray paint instead of a gloss, because the oil paint will have an easier time sticking to the matte surface. Matte finishes are considered to be toothy, so the oil paint will adhere nicely to that type of paint.
While oil paints can be used on top of spray paints, it is important to remember that it won’t work the other way around. You can’t use spray paint on top of oil paint because the paint will not adhere to the surface. When you use oil paint over spray paint, it is essential that the spray paint is all the way dry first.
What Paint Will Stick to Spray Paint?

If you are wanting to paint over spray paint, you need to make sure you are using a paint that will stick to the surface. Acrylic paint and oil paint are the two main types of paints that will stick to spray paint.
Spray paint is solvent based, so conditions need to be right for any type of paint to properly stick. It is best to use a primer on top of the spray paint that is made for the type of paint you are using.

For acrylic paint, you can use an acrylic primer. For oil paint, you can use an oil primer. If you want to use both, you can use a gesso primer. Gesso has been proven to increase adhesion of both acrylic paint and oil paint to a surface.
Can You Brush Paint Over Spray Paint?

It is possible to brush paint over spray paint if you do so correctly. The very first thing you need to do is make sure the spray paint is completely dry before you do anything. If the spray paint is old, then you don’t need to worry about waiting for it to dry.
Next, you will need to lightly sand the surface of the spray paint. Grab a 100-grit sandpaper and very gently sand the surface where you are planning to brush the paint on. This will help give the paint something to stick to.
After you are finished sanding, clean the surface with a damp cloth. Wipe down the entire surface, even the areas you didn’t sand. This will get rid of any residue that is still on the surface of the spray paint after you finish sanding. Make sure you give the surface plenty of time to dry as you don’t want to work over a damp surface.
You will then want to add a primer to the surface. This will guarantee that you are working with an even surface, and it will enhance the adhesion of the paint to the surface. It is best to apply at least two thin, even layers of primer to your project. Let each layer dry thoroughly before working on the next.

As soon as the primer is dry, you can apply the brush paint. You will get the best results by using a high-quality brush that is at an angle. Apply thin coats of your chosen paint and let each coat completely dry before you add the next.
You should get plenty of coverage with two coats of paint, but you can add more if you feel like the project needs more coverage. Let the paint completely dry and cure before you try to move your project.
Will Acrylic Paint Stay on Spray Paint?

Acrylic paint will stay on spray paint, but you need to follow a certain procedure to ensure that it does. You are going to start by sanding the surface of the spray paint with a 100-grit sandpaper. The purpose of doing this isn’t to get rid of the spray paint, so be very careful.
You will also want to make sure you are applying even pressure across the entire surface of the spray paint. If not, you can end up with noticeable patches that show through the acrylic. You only want to remove the shine from the spray paint.
Next, you are going to clean the surface so it’s free of any dust, dirt, and debris from when you were sanding the surface. You can use some warm soapy water and a clean rag to gently wipe off the surface. Make sure it is completely dry before you add the primer. If the surface is damp, there is a huge chance of the acrylic peeling in the future.
Apply the primer when you are positive that the surface is dry. It is highly recommended that you use a gesso primer for the best results. This is because gesso adheres to solvent based paints and water-based paints, so it will easily adhere to both the spray paint and acrylic paint.
Paint with the acrylic paint in thin, even layers. It is best to apply at least two layers of acrylic because one layer will be too transparent. If you want an opaquer look, you can add more than two layers.
Finally, you will need to seal the acrylic paint. Use an acrylic sealer after the acrylic paint has dried completely. The sealant will protect your painting from damage and debris, keeping it looking good as new for as long as possible.
Can I Put Latex Paint Over Spray Paint?
You can also use latex paint over spray paint if you follow the same instructions used with acrylic paint. You will need to sand the spray paint, use a primer, and add a sealant when you are finished to protect the surface.
